Notice Title
Supply of internal audit services 2019 - 2022
Notice Description
Langstane Housing Association Limited is following an Open procurement procedure in accordance with the requirements of the Public Contracts (Scotland) Regulation 2015/The Procurement Reform (Scotland) Act 2014 to appoint a supplier to provide an internal audit service. The internal audit service is responsible for providing an objective, independent assessment of all Langstane's activities, financial and otherwise. It should provide a service to the whole Association including the Board and Audit Committee, subsidiary board of directors and all levels of management. The term of the contract of internal audit services will be for a period of 3 years from 1 April 2019, with an option to extend on a year to year basis for up to a further 2 years.

Tender evaluation model An contract awarded as a result of this procurement will be awarded on the basis of the offer that is the most economically advantageous to Langstane on the basis of the best price-quality ration. Tenders will be evaluated using the following Award Criteria; Cost will have a weighting of 45% Quality will have a weighting of 55% broken down as follows; Experience and Resources 25% Sustainability and Environmental 10% Fair Work Practices 10% Qualification and skills of key team members 25% Scores are arrived at following the application of the Evaluation Criteria set out within the tender

Open Contracting Data Standard (OCDS)
The Open Contracting Data Standard (OCDS) is a framework designed to increase transparency and access to public procurement data in the public sector. It is widely used by governments and organisations worldwide to report on procurement processes and contracts.
